Hyperwar: A Hypertext History of the Second World War
http://www.ibiblio.org/hyperwar/
This is a collection of material related to the (primarily military) history of the Second World War, completely cross-referenced via hypertext links. It includes official government histories (United States and British Commonwealth/Empire); Source documents (diplomatic messages, Action Reports, logs, diaries, etc.; and primary references (manuals, glossaries, etc. Wherever possible, hyperlinks between these histories and documents have been included.
The "Order of Battle" information was compiled by the HyperWar authors. This currently includes pages for each of the ships in the U.S. Fleet; a start on pages for U.S. Army Divisions; and a smaller start on pages for U.S. Marine Corps Divisions.
